About the role
You will join the Infrastructure team to refine our build systems and developer tooling, with a primary focus on Bazel and C++ environments. In this capacity, you will drive cross-company initiatives that enable firmware and microservice developers to iterate more efficiently and with greater confidence. The role requires you to act as a technical leader who shapes how foundational tools are designed, maintained, and evangelized across the organization. You will own the roadmap for engineering tooling, ensuring that it aligns with both immediate project needs and long-term scalability goals. A core part of your work will involve improving the daily developer experience and productivity across the entire company. You will oversee Kubernetes development and deployment tools to create a seamless and reliable workflow for distributed teams. Furthermore, you will develop and maintain testing frameworks for both software and hardware, ensuring robust validation throughout the development lifecycle. Finally, you will provide technical guidance and support to other engineering teams while assisting in scaling and growing the engineering organization through process and platform improvements.

Practical notes
- Annual pay range: $130,000 to $280,000 USD.
- Compensation includes base pay and eligibility for equity in the form of Restricted Stock Units.
- Visa sponsorship is available and the company will assist with the process for successful candidates.
- Benefits include 100% covered employee healthcare premiums (80% for family), HSA/FSA options, mental health support, paid parental leave, fertility benefits, professional development stipends, daily lunches, and commuter benefits.
